Hill Country Festival is an upbeat, Western-style overture that draws inspiration from being out in the Texas Hill Country. There's no specific story or program to the piece, although the middle section is reminiscent of being at the top of Enchanted Rock State Park and looking out at the view of the surrounding landscape. The piece is written in a symmetrical arch form: Introduction, A allegro section, B andante section, A' return of allegro section with variations, and Coda, which reprises the Introduction. Hill Country Festival is dedicated to Bill Haehnel, for his 20 years of service as Assistant Director of the Austin Symphonic Band.
